Syrian Authorities Have Banned Women in Latakia From Wearing Makeup at Work, Facing Sharp Criticism

Summary by echo24.cz
Syrian authorities in the western province of Latakia have banned female public sector employees from wearing make-up at work. The decision has sparked outrage and many Syrians have expressed concerns about restricting personal freedoms. Authorities responded by saying the aim was not to restrict anyone but rather to "regulate professional appearance and prevent excessive use of cosmetics," according to AFP.
